Shell

Permanently closed
8611 S Western Ave
Los Angeles, CA 90047

Shell has been a prominent player in the U.S. energy sector for over a century, consistently delivering secure energy supplies while adapting to the evolving landscape of energy consumption. The company focuses on providing quality products and services, including innovative fuel options like Shell V-Power NiTRO Premium Gasoline, aimed at enhancing vehicle performance.

With a commitment to sustainability, Shell strives to meet today's energy demands while building the systems needed for a more sustainable future. The company prioritizes creating value for both society and its shareholders, emphasizing the importance of responsible energy provision.

Generated from the website

Own this business?
See a problem?

You might also like

Partial Data by Foursquare.